Luminosa DDH IPA. New season Luminosa from Indie Hops and Motueka bring an abundance of peach lemonade, candied orange, and lemon sherbet notes to this pillowy IPA.

Keg at Bundo, Mcr. Pours murky orange with white foam. Aroma: peach, lemon, lime, melon, floral. Taste: towards moderate sweet with milder bitterness, stone fruits, melon, orange, citrus zest. Light to medium body with soft carbonation. Interesting new hop.

Can. Mildly hazy gold beer, small pale cream colour head. Palate is airy and fairly dry, good fine minerally carbonation. Light malts, slightly thin, a decent thin creamy sweetness. Luminosa hops bring that bright spritzy citrus, lemonade is the wrong description but, it is a bright lemongrass tinged bright pine. Light bright tropical fruits. Not getting any berries at all but, a nice presentation of this new hop. Given how popular it is, I hope some enterprising brewer will do a silly hopped dipa soon.

Can from Lupe Pintos. Hazy golden body with a white head. Steady carbonation. Faint lacing. Aroma of lemon, lime and peach sorbet. Flavour of the orange bit from a jaffa cake and lemon sponge. Thin to medium body with a slick texture. Light fizz. A smooth, tangy IPA.
